POIKILODERMA

 

As a morphologic term, poikiloderma refers to the combination of atrophy, telangiectasia, and varied pigmentary changes (hyper- and hypo-) over an area of skin. This combination of features may give rise to a dappled appearance to the skin. The distribution of poikiloderma varies according to etiology. Because of some confusion in the past stemming from the use of the word poikiloderma in the naming of specific syndromes, it is probably best to restrict its use to a descriptive. A clinical example is chronic radiodermatitis
